What are the 3 main sources of waste water?

  1. Households (domestic).
  2. Agriculture.
  3. Industrial processes.

What 2 things must be removed from sewage and agricultural waste water?

  1. Organic matter.
  2. Harmful microbes.

Why does water from industrial processes require additional treatment?

It may contain harmful chemicals that were formed during the industrial chemical reactions.

Outline the steps in the treatment of sewage.

  1. Screening - the sewage is passed through gratings and meshes to remove anything large.
  2. Sedimentation - the sewage is left to sit in a settlement tank, so that the heavier particles settle at the bottom as sludge, while the lighter particles settle at the top as effluent. 
  3. Aerobic digestion - air is pumped through the effluent to supply the bacteria with oxygen.
  4. Anaerobic digestion - the sludge is sealed in a container to prevent the entry of air, which ensures anaerobic respiration.

After sewage treatment, what can the products of the anaerobic digestion process be used for?

The methane (gas) can be burned as an energy source.


The sludge can be used as a fertiliser.
